🪝 Bounce and Hook – Swing, Miss, Try Again

Bounce and Hook is sneaky. At first glance you think, “Alright, tap to swing. How hard could that be?” But give it a few minutes and suddenly you’re muttering at your screen because you missed by half a second… again.

You play as this tiny ball that refuses to stay on the ground. Your job? Keep hooking from point to point, swinging higher and higher. Sounds like a breeze, but the timing will mess with you. Tap too soon and you drop like a stone. Tap too late and you smack into nothing. Every fail comes with that nagging thought: “Okay, just one more try—I’ve got it this time.”

The early stages reel you in with easy hooks and forgiving timing, making you feel unstoppable. Then, out of nowhere, the hooks spread farther apart, the rhythm shifts, and you’re holding your breath waiting for the exact moment to tap. When you finally hit it perfectly—when the ball swings smooth and soars upward—it’s insanely satisfying.

That’s the magic of it. No overcomplicated graphics, no endless gimmicks. Just that pure rush of nailing the swing after failing a dozen times. And if you stick around, you’ll watch that little ball climb higher than you thought possible. Weirdly rewarding for something so simple.

Bounce and Hook isn’t just another tap game. It’s the kind that whispers “one more try” until you’ve been playing way longer than you planned.
